The contract involves finalizing architectural plans to ensure full compliance with ministerial design review standards under the City of Riverside’s Housing Element Update and in accordance with CEQA §15183. This subcontract focuses on refining design documentation to align with state and local housing goals, particularly those aimed at streamlining development while maintaining environmental and aesthetic guidelines. The work supports the city’s broader strategy to increase housing density and affordability through efficiently approved projects that meet statutory requirements. Performance of the contract is centered in Riverside, California, with the NAICS code 541310 indicating that the services fall under architectural services. The project is tied to the city’s efforts to expedite housing approvals while upholding environmental review standards, requiring close coordination with municipal planning objectives. All deliverables must satisfy the ministerial review criteria established by the Housing Element Update, ensuring that architectural designs are not only compliant but also contribute to the city’s capacity to meet regional housing needs under state law.

Design Services for Building New Career and Technical Education Center (CTE)
Solicitation # 26-7159-05
Richmond Public Schools is soliciting design services for a new Career and Technical Education Center to support its Passion4Learning high school redesign. This center will serve as a hub for five comprehensive high schools, providing theme-based programming and diverse instructional environments, including specialized labs, shops, and flexible learning studios aligned with current employment trends. The project aims to prepare students for higher education, high-earning careers, or national service through rigorous, hands-on learning and peer collaboration. Solicitation 26-7159-05 was posted on August 19, 2026, with a response deadline of September 18, 2026. The contract is a professional services agreement governed by the Virginia Public Procurement Act and requires the selected contractor to perform work in Richmond, Virginia. Key compliance requirements include mandatory criminal background checks for employees with student contact, certifications regarding a drug-free workplace, and disclosures of any relationships with School Board employees. The contractor must also adhere to Title VI and VII of the Civil Rights Act and maintain all contract-related records for at least three years for audit purposes. Payment is contingent upon the submission of detailed invoices referencing a School Board purchase order, and the contractor is obligated to pay subcontractors within seven days of receiving payment.
